Internal Quality Assurance System for faculties and schools

The process-based management system used by the UAB faculties and schools stems from a commitment to offering degrees with their own policy on quality and measures in place to evaluate and improve performance continuously, according to the European quality standards. These elements together make up this university's Internal Quality Assurance System (SGIQ).

This system involves all the following:

  • establishing and monitoring the faculty's policy and objectives regarding teaching standards, in accordance with the university’s strategic lines
  • establishing and renewing the offer of PhD programmes
  • processes directly linked to teaching activity: tutoring, assessment, mobility, etc.
  • processes to gauge the level of satisfaction of the different groups
  • processes linked to the people and resources needed: lecturers, administrative and service staff (PAS), infrastructure and services, course scheduling, academic organisation, etc.
  • processes linked to the life cycles of degrees: verification (evaluation before implementation), regular monitoring, modification (continuous improvement) and accreditation (evaluation of performance and renewal of the authorisation to continue offering the programme), which seek to organise, renew and improve the offer of PhD programmes.

Verification

Evaluation process previous to the implementation of the degree: presentation of a proposal for a new PhD programme for AQU-Catalunya (Agency for the Quality of the University System of Catalonia) to issue the binding evaluation for the Council of Universities (Ministry of Universities), which is the responsible agent for verification.

 

Monitoring

Periodic monitoring process of the development and results of the PhD programme: self-evaluation carried out, every 3 years, by themselves.

 

Accreditation

Renewal process for the implementation of the degree: presentation, every 6 years since the implementation of the program, of a self-report for AQU-Catalunya to issue the binding assessment for the University Council, which is the responsible agent of accreditation.

The following prizes and honours have been awarded in relation to this PhD programme.

  • In May 2010 PhD student Lorenzo Burlon received the prize for best article at the Meeting of PhDs in Montpellier (DMM, third edition).
  • In November 2010 PhD student Lorenzo Burlon received the Louis-André Gérard-Varet award for the best article presented by a young economist at the annual Meeting of the Association of Southern European Economic Theorists (ASSET).
  • In September 2011 PhD student Jan Grobovsek received the Fondazioni Eni Enrico Mattei prize for one of the three best papers to be presented at the meeting of the European Economic Association.
  • In 2011 PhD Student Pau Balart received the Louis-André Gérard-Varet prize for the best article presented by a young economist at the annual meeting of the Association of Southern European Economic Theorists (ASSET).
  • In November 2012 PhD student Tugce Cuhadaroglu received the Louis-André Gérard-Varet prize for the best article presented by a young economist at the annual Meeting of the Association of Southern European Economic Theorists (ASSET).
  • In 2011 PhD student Pau Pujolas received the prize for one of the three best papers to be presented at the 16th Workshop on Dynamic Macroeconomics in Vigo.
